How PVC Affects Action Figure Weight and Feel

Introduction: Pick up two action figures of a similar size and you will often notice differences that have nothing to do with paint or sculpt.

One may feel heavier and more substantial, while the other feels lighter and easier to move. The usual reason is the material used for the body, joints, and accessories. Across the hobby, that material is most often PVC. Knowing how PVC affects weight, flex, and surface feel helps you judge what a figure will be like in hand before you unbox it, and it makes it easier to choose a piece for a permanent display, regular posing, or a mix of both. Because the exact material mix varies from one figure to another, use this background together with the material note on the product listing.

Why PVC is common in action figure production

An action figure is a small model of a character from a film or story, with movable parts. PVC, or polyvinyl chloride, is one of the most widely used plastics in the world, found in pipes, window frames, medical tubing, and toys. For action figures, the important quality is that PVC can be formulated to behave in different ways. The same base material can be rigid enough to hold the shape of an armored chest or soft enough to let a cape, skirt, or joint cover bend without cracking. PVC is also well suited to high-volume molding. It fills small details cleanly, which is why mass-produced figures can have crisp panel lines and subtle surface texture. It gives paint a stable surface to bond with, so layered finishes hold up during normal posing. It also fits into a practical cost range for collectible toys. PVC is common because it balances cost, detail, rigidity, flexibility, and paint compatibility better than most alternatives. That balance is why many listings describe a figure as PVC, and why two figures made from the same material can still feel completely different.

How PVC changes weight, flex, and surface feel in hand

The practical difference is obvious the moment you handle a figure. Weight comes from material density, part thickness, and overall engineering, not from the plastic type alone.

1. Dense PVC parts feel heavier while thin joints and soft accessories stay flexible

Solid, thick PVC parts feel dense in the hand. A torso with a thick wall gives a figure a satisfying amount of heft, which is why two figures of the same height can feel very different. Thin arms, hollow legs, and separate joint pieces reduce overall weight, keeping the figure light enough to pose without putting excessive stress on the articulation. Softer PVC is common in moving parts as well. Capes, skirts, holsters, and some joint covers use a more pliable blend so they can flex out of the way during posing. The result is a figure that feels sturdy in the chest, moves smoothly in the arms, and has soft accessories that do not fight the pose. For comparison, some premium lines add die-cast metal to selected areas for a colder, heavier feel. Heavier is not automatically better. Metal parts cost more, can chip or flake where parts rub together, and shift the figure's balance. A well-designed PVC figure often stands more securely and is easier to handle during regular display and posing.

2. Surface texture and paint grip on PVC change how a figure reads on the shelf

PVC surfaces vary from one product to another. The finish can be matte, gloss, or satin, and each one changes how the figure looks under normal room light. A glossy armor section reflects light and reads as polished metal, while a matte surface looks more like painted fabric or weathered steel. Because PVC holds fine sculpted detail, panel lines and surface textures stay visible under the paint, which is why collector figures look sharp even from across the room. Paint grip is just as important as texture. PVC gives paint a stable base, so manufacturers can apply shading and topcoats without the finish lifting during normal handling. However, soft PVC parts have limits. Heat, long-term sunlight, and contact with certain other plastics can slowly affect them, so storage matters as much as the material itself.

How to use material details when choosing an action figure

Material information is most useful when it tells you what kind of feel you prefer. For a display shelf, a heavier body and secure footing may give you more confidence. For frequent posing, joint flexibility and soft accessories matter more than raw weight. Neither preference is a universal quality signal; it is a clue about which design suits your habits. Material is one input among several in the full specification. Two figures that both list PVC can feel different because of scale, proportion, wall thickness, articulation design, and paint finish. FAQ

Q:How does PVC affect the weight and feel of an action figure?

A:PVC can be formulated in different ways, so its effect depends on the figure's design. Thick, dense PVC parts add heft, while thinner sections and softer blends keep joints moveable and accessories flexible. That is why a figure can feel solid in the torso yet light in the arms, and why two PVC figures of the same scale can feel completely different in hand.

Q:Why do many action figures use PVC instead of metal?

A:PVC is less expensive to mold at high volume, captures fine sculpt detail well, and can be made rigid or flexible depending on the part. Full metal construction is heavier, more expensive, and more likely to chip at friction points, so metal is usually reserved for decorative accents or structural joints in premium pieces. PVC gives a balanced feel that is easier to pose and handle over time.

Q:How should I care for PVC action figures at home?

A:Keep PVC figures out of direct sunlight and away from heat sources, since long exposure can cause fading or warping on soft parts. Dust them with a soft dry cloth and avoid harsh solvents that can damage paint or surface finish.
